2020-06-16 01:43:09 +08:00
|
|
|
|
# 参与开发
|
|
|
|
|
|
|
|
|
|
Hyperf 是一个开源项目,一个开源项目的发展离不开开源社区的力量支持,如果您希望参与 Hyperf 的开发,可以先从 [issues](https://github.com/hyperf/hyperf/issues?page=2&q=is%3Aissue+is%3Aopen) 开始,通常来说会有以下的一些步骤:
|
|
|
|
|
|
|
|
|
|
1. 关注 [issues](https://github.com/hyperf/hyperf/issues?page=2&q=is%3Aissue+is%3Aopen) 的动态,评论回复帮助提出疑问的用户;
|
2020-06-26 14:23:50 +08:00
|
|
|
|
2. 根据 [issues](https://github.com/hyperf/hyperf/issues?page=2&q=is%3Aissue+is%3Aopen) 的内容,找寻根据自己当前对 Hyperf 的了解程度,去修复力所能及的 BUG 或实现功能,并以 [Pull Request](https://github.com/hyperf/hyperf/pulls) 的形式提交至 [hyperf/hyperf](https://github.com/hyperf/hyperf) 仓库;
|
2020-06-16 01:43:09 +08:00
|
|
|
|
3. 关注自己提交 Pull Request 的进度和状态,以推动您的 Pull Request 尽快合入主仓库;
|
|
|
|
|
4. 对其他人提交的 Pull Request 进行 Code Review,并给出您的建议和看法。
|
|
|
|
|
5. 根据他人或自己的需求,研发独立的功能组件;
|
|
|
|
|
6. 坚持并持续进行上述步骤。
|
|
|
|
|
|
|
|
|
|
## 加入 Hyperf 团队
|
|
|
|
|
|
2020-06-18 08:20:39 +08:00
|
|
|
|
Hyperf 团队是对 Hyperf 项目及其周边项目进行持续维护和迭代的团队,如果您希望加入其中,首先需要您对 Hyperf 和开源拥有足够且持续的热情和动力,因为需要您付出大量的时间和精力到 Hyperf 项目及其周边项目的维护和迭代工作上,同时也需要您对 Hyperf 项目有足够的深入了解,以便维护工作的进行。因此我们对加入 Hyperf 团队也设有一定的门槛,**您需要在 [hyperf/hyperf](https://github.com/hyperf/hyperf) 仓库拥有最少 100 commits,或向 Hyperf 提交了多个优秀的组件,同时由任一现有的 Hyperf 团队成员提名,并获得团队内超半数成员的同意**。
|
2020-06-16 01:43:09 +08:00
|
|
|
|
|
|
|
|
|
加入到 Hyperf 团队,您会得到包括但不限于以下的收获:
|
|
|
|
|
1. @hyperf.io E-mail
|
|
|
|
|
2. [Jetbrains All Products Pack](https://www.jetbrains.com/store/#commercial?billing=yearly) (US $649/year)
|
|
|
|
|
3. [Github team membership](https://github.com/orgs/hyperf/people)
|